Survey and inventory of hospitals and health centers.

The State Commissioner of Health shall conduct and make a survey and inventory of the location, size, and character of all existing public and private (proprietary as well as nonprofit) hospitals, community mental health facilities, health centers, and related health facilities within the State of Oklahoma; evaluate the sufficiency of such hospitals, community mental health facilities, health centers, and related health facilities to supply the necessary physical facilities for furnishing adequate hospital, clinical, and similar services to all people of the state; and compile data and conclusions, together with a statement of the additional facilities necessary, in conjunction with existing structures, to supply such services.

Laws 1963, c. 325, art. 7, § 711, operative July 1, 1963; Laws 1965, c. 36, § 2, emerg. eff. March 8, 1965.
